No specific book recommendations, but the CBOE offers very informative
seminars, conducted at 3 different levels by experienced professionals --
They are normally given in Chicago or at other remote locations when
sponsored by a local Brokerage firm.  
         
The CBOE Site at www.cboe.com also has a lot of good educational information.
